  4. The visors are seperate as we wanted to allow customizers to swap different colored visors on different colored helmets. RedBean actually designed this piece and I've often thought their styles are fairly similar (which is why I personally admire both). Keep in mind that the proportion of a standard minifig is not reflective of an actual person. As a result all of our accessories will reflect the same proportion as official elements which are also slightly-larger scale. Even though the Gladius is considered a Shortsowrd you'll find it to be smaller than a LEGO Shortsword. Shortsword length ranges anywhere from 30-45 inches whereas the Gladius is often 25-31 inches so we feel there is a bit of leniency here. Historical Pilums were usually around 2 meters (6.56 feet) high and given the 'short' stature of the minifig in comparison we felt there was a lot of wiggle room. Also, the Pilum was traditionally grasped at the joint-block or counterweight - which a minifig can't really grasp - thus we had to place these elements towards the upper portion of the spear lending to its length. The iron head was indeed exaggerated by us, but only because we wanted to construct an iconic weapon. The alternative would have been to cut the length of the shaft in half and reduce the flare of the tip resulting in what we thought would have been an incomplete piece. There were several styles of roman shields over its 1000 yr history, including several that were fairly flat and more rounded. Our tooling prevented us from making anything that would encompass a minifig 180 degrees so we opted for a smaller, rounded and flatter shield. You won't see a center boss because we encourage using decals to turn the piece into anything you want. An iron knot would have made such customization more difficult. The face guards were more or less a nod to the official DragonMaster's helmet which we always thought would be the defacto Roman helmet if there was to ever be an official theme. We really aren't out to construct exact mini-scale replicas of popular historical items. We want these items to be recognizable and playable so I'm not ashamed to say that some artistic licensing does take place at BrickForge.   15. Hey Tin, Thanks for contacting BF. I know I already replied to your e-mail but thought some of the information regarding professional molding capabilities would be appreciated by the rest in the community. Indeed, the cost to create an individual mold can vary depending on which country you are in, but remains pretty expensive none-the-less....in the thousands. That initial investment is madeup over time by selling pieces in larger volumes. Usually, there are minimum quantity requirements that need to be considered as well. To design an entire mold ready for plastic injection around one or two pieces that will never see distribution is sort of like using a mallet to alleviate a headache. Your best bet here is to find someone to either sculpt and cast a single piece, or draw it in CAD and send it to somewhere like Protomold.com. The latter costs around $1,000 but you will get a professional-looking piece usually free and clear of defects and air bubbles. -A

  22. I use Brasso w/ a paper towel, religiously. Paper towels are dimpled and provide a better surface to help rub off the print. Not to mention you can fold the paper towel around the minifig (cushioning and leverage) and use sort of a snapping/pinching motion to take the print off faster. I'll use an X-acto blade to remove pesky corners or small details. Metallic print is by far the hardest to fully remove. -A
